Die Fähigkeit, in Editing-Software präzise zu zoomen, ist fundamental für nahezu jeden Bearbeitungsprozess, sei es in der Videobearbeitung, Bildbearbeitung oder im Audiobereich. Ein gutes Zoom-System ermöglicht nicht nur eine genauere Betrachtung feiner Details, sondern beschleunigt auch den Workflow und reduziert das Risiko von Fehlern. Aber wie funktioniert stufenloses Zoomen wirklich, und was macht ein gutes Zoom-Erlebnis aus? Dieser Artikel taucht tief in die Technologie und Best Practices ein, die stufenloses Zoomen in Editing-Software auszeichnen.
Die Grundlagen des stufenlosen Zoomens
Im Gegensatz zu älteren, diskreten Zoom-Funktionen, die nur vordefinierte Zoomstufen boten (z.B. 50%, 100%, 200%), ermöglicht stufenloses Zoomen eine nahtlose und kontinuierliche Veränderung der Zoomstufe. Das bedeutet, man kann sich Pixel für Pixel dem gewünschten Detail nähern, ohne störende Sprünge oder Unterbrechungen.
Technisch gesehen basiert stufenloses Zoomen in der Regel auf einer Kombination aus Algorithmen und Hardwarebeschleunigung. Die Software verwendet Interpolationsmethoden, um die Pixel zwischen den tatsächlichen Datenpunkten zu berechnen und so ein vergrößertes Bild darzustellen. Je höher die Zoomstufe, desto deutlicher werden die Artefakte, wenn die Interpolation nicht hochwertig ist. Daher ist eine ausgeklügelte Interpolationstechnologie entscheidend für ein scharfes und detailreiches Ergebnis.
Es gibt verschiedene Interpolationsmethoden, die zum Einsatz kommen können, darunter:
* **Nächster Nachbar:** Die einfachste Methode, bei der jedem neuen Pixel der Wert des nächstgelegenen vorhandenen Pixels zugewiesen wird. Dies ist schnell, führt aber zu einem blockartigen Aussehen.
* **Bilinear:** Berechnet den Wert eines neuen Pixels basierend auf dem gewichteten Durchschnitt der vier umliegenden Pixel. Bietet ein glatteres Ergebnis als die Nächster-Nachbar-Methode.
* **Bikubisch:** Verwendet eine komplexere Berechnung, die die Werte der 16 umliegenden Pixel berücksichtigt. Erzeugt das schärfste und detailreichste Ergebnis, ist aber auch rechenintensiver.
Moderne Editing-Software nutzt oft GPU-Beschleunigung, um die rechenintensiven Interpolationsprozesse zu entlasten. Die Grafikkarte übernimmt die Berechnung der interpolierten Pixel, wodurch die CPU entlastet und die Gesamtleistung der Software verbessert wird.
Bedienelemente und Interaktion
Die Art und Weise, wie ein Nutzer mit der Zoomfunktion interagiert, ist ebenso wichtig wie die zugrunde liegende Technologie. Die gängigsten Bedienelemente für stufenloses Zoomen sind:
* **Mausrad:** Eine intuitive und weit verbreitete Methode. Durch Drehen des Mausrads kann man sanft hinein- oder herauszoomen. Oft in Kombination mit einer Modifikatortaste (z.B. Strg, Cmd, Alt), um das Scrollen im horizontalen oder vertikalen Bereich zu steuern.
* **Touchgesten:** Auf Geräten mit Touchscreen-Funktionalität sind Pinch-to-Zoom-Gesten üblich und intuitiv.
* **Tastenkombinationen:** Dedizierte Tastenkombinationen (z.B. „+” und „-„) ermöglichen schnelles und präzises Zoomen, besonders nützlich für wiederholte Aufgaben.
* **Zoom-Slider:** Eine visuelle Steuerung, die es ermöglicht, die Zoomstufe direkt anzupassen. Bietet oft eine numerische Anzeige der aktuellen Zoomstufe.
Ein gutes Zoom-System bietet eine reaktionsschnelle und flüssige Erfahrung. Die Zoomänderung sollte sofort auf die Eingabe des Nutzers reagieren, ohne Verzögerung oder Ruckeln. Dies erfordert eine effiziente Programmierung und optimierte Algorithmen.
Best Practices für stufenloses Zoomen in Editing-Software
Hier sind einige Best Practices, die Entwickler und Nutzer berücksichtigen sollten, um das bestmögliche Zoom-Erlebnis zu gewährleisten:
* **Leistung:** Die Software sollte auch bei hohen Zoomstufen flüssig und reaktionsschnell bleiben. GPU-Beschleunigung und optimierte Interpolationsalgorithmen sind entscheidend.
* **Präzision:** Die Zoomstufen sollten fein genug sein, um eine genaue Betrachtung kleinster Details zu ermöglichen. Der Zoomfaktor sollte anpassbar sein, um den Bedürfnissen des Nutzers gerecht zu werden.
* **Intuitive Bedienung:** Die Bedienelemente sollten intuitiv und leicht zu erlernen sein. Die Möglichkeit, verschiedene Bedienelemente (Mausrad, Touchgesten, Tastenkombinationen) zu nutzen, erhöht die Flexibilität.
* **Information:** Die aktuelle Zoomstufe sollte klar angezeigt werden, idealerweise numerisch oder visuell.
* **Zoom-Fokus:** Die Software sollte es dem Nutzer ermöglichen, den Fokuspunkt des Zooms festzulegen. Dies ermöglicht es, gezielt auf bestimmte Bereiche zu zoomen, ohne den Überblick zu verlieren. Beispielsweise durch einen Klick an die gewünschte Stelle als Zoomzentrum.
* **Zoom-Speicher:** Die Möglichkeit, bestimmte Zoomstufen zu speichern und schnell wiederherzustellen, kann den Workflow erheblich beschleunigen.
* **Adaptive Zoom:** Die Software könnte die Interpolationsmethode dynamisch an die Zoomstufe anpassen. Bei niedrigen Zoomstufen könnte eine schnellere, aber weniger präzise Methode verwendet werden, während bei hohen Zoomstufen eine langsamere, aber präzisere Methode zum Einsatz kommt.
* **Anti-Aliasing:** Um Treppeneffekte bei hohen Zoomstufen zu reduzieren, sollte die Software Anti-Aliasing-Techniken verwenden.
Herausforderungen und zukünftige Entwicklungen
Obwohl stufenloses Zoomen in moderner Editing-Software weit verbreitet ist, gibt es immer noch Herausforderungen. Eine davon ist die Bewältigung extrem großer Dateien und hoher Auflösungen. Die Verarbeitung von 4K- oder 8K-Videos oder hochauflösenden Bildern erfordert erhebliche Rechenleistung und Speicherkapazität.
Zukünftige Entwicklungen im Bereich des stufenlosen Zoomens könnten Folgendes umfassen:
* **Verbesserte Interpolationsalgorithmen:** Fortschrittliche Algorithmen, die auf künstlicher Intelligenz (KI) basieren, könnten noch schärfere und detailreichere Zoom-Ergebnisse liefern. KI-gestütztes Upscaling könnte sogar fehlende Details rekonstruieren.
* **Optimierte Hardwarebeschleunigung:** Noch engere Integration mit der Hardware, insbesondere mit modernen GPUs, könnte die Leistung und Effizienz des Zoomens weiter verbessern.
* **Verbesserte Touch-Interaktion:** Präzisere und intuitivere Touchgesten, die es dem Nutzer ermöglichen, noch feiner zu zoomen und zu navigieren.
* **Integration mit Cloud-basierten Editing-Plattformen:** Ermöglicht nahtloses Zoomen und Bearbeiten von Dateien, die in der Cloud gespeichert sind.
Fazit
Stufenloses Zoomen ist ein unverzichtbares Werkzeug für alle, die mit Editing-Software arbeiten. Ein gut implementiertes Zoom-System ermöglicht präzises Arbeiten, beschleunigt den Workflow und verbessert die Gesamtqualität der Bearbeitung. Durch die Berücksichtigung der in diesem Artikel beschriebenen Best Practices können Entwickler Software erstellen, die ein außergewöhnliches Zoom-Erlebnis bietet. Und Nutzer können die Möglichkeiten des stufenlosen Zoomens voll ausschöpfen, um ihre kreativen Visionen zum Leben zu erwecken. Die kontinuierliche Weiterentwicklung der Technologie verspricht in Zukunft noch beeindruckendere und präzisere Zoom-Funktionen, die die Möglichkeiten der Bearbeitung weiter erweitern werden.